Abstract: A display device includes a display panel having a display area and a peripheral area. The display device includes a circuit having a comparator, and first and second sense wires disposed in the peripheral area and connected to the circuit. The comparator compares a first output signal output from the first sense wire and a second output signal output from the second sense wire to generate a comparison result. The circuit determines whether a defect is present in the display device based on the comparison result.

Abstract: A pixel circuit includes a driving transistor which generates a driving current and including a first electrode connected to a first node, a gate electrode connected to a gate node, and a second electrode connected to a second node, a writing transistor connected to the driving transistor through the first node and including a first electrode which receives a data voltage, a gate electrode which receives a write gate signal, and a second electrode connected to the first node, a compensation transistor including a gate electrode, a first electrode connected to the gate node, and a second electrode connected to the second node, a gate-drain capacitor connected in parallel with the compensation transistor and including a first electrode connected to the gate node and a second electrode connected to the second node, and a light emitting element that emits light based on the driving current.

Abstract: A display device includes a display panel including pixel driving circuits and light emitting elements, a data driver that outputs data voltages to the pixel driving circuits, and a timing controller that controls the data driver. The data driver includes a first amplifier and second amplifiers. The first amplifier outputs first data voltages to a first data line connected to first pixel driving circuits arranged in a first column and output second data voltages to a second data line connected to second pixel driving circuits arranged in a second column. The second amplifiers output third data voltages to third data lines connected to third pixel driving circuits arranged in third columns which are disposed between the first column and the second column. Thus, the display device reduces the number of amplifiers included in the data driver.
